First Hydrogen’s (FHYD) subsidiary, First Hydrogen Ltd, has appointed Afkenel Schipstra as Chief Operational Officer to grow the Energy division.

Schipstra joins from the multinational utility company ENGIE where she was the Senior Vice President of Hydrogen Business Development. She was responsible for large-scale hydrogen projects in the Netherlands, including HyNetherlands.

Prior to ENGIE, Schipstra was Hydrogen Program Manager at TSO Gasunie N.V. In her previous role as Senior Business Development Manager; she worked on carbon capture, usage and storage (CCUS) and district heating projects. She is also a Non-Executive Director and Chair of the Audit & Risk Committee of HydrogenOne Capital Growth plc.

She is passionate about bringing more women into the industry and is an active member of Women in Hydrogen and a founding member of VIEN. 

Schipstra holds a Masters degree from the Rotterdam School of Management. She is a Registered Controller with more than 15 years of extensive experience in business leadership and financial management for the Energy sector. At First Hydrogen, she will assist the company in establishing environmentally sustainable green hydrogen production sites and delivering its refuelling solutions.

First Hydrogen is a designer and manufacturer of zero-emission, long-range hydrogen-powered utility vehicles in the UK, EU, and North America.
